he Capalbio D.O.C. appellation is applicable to wines produced in the hilly territories in the south of the province of Grosseto, in Tuscany - an area bordering on the Natural Reserve of the Maremma and embracing the municipalities of Magliano, Capalbio, Orbetello and Marciano.The presence here of two other D.O.C. wines, Parrina and Ansonica Costa dell'Argentario, testify to the ancient winegrowing traditions of this land. After all, there is plenty of historical evidence that the ancients used to export the wine produced in this area to far away lands using the ancient Roman port of Cosa. In the Middle Ages too, as well as in the 17th century, the wines produced here were regularly exported. Capalbio D.O.C. applies to both red and white grapes produced in the vineyards of the rolling, sun-drenched hills just beyond the typically Mediterranean maquis of the coastline. Thanks to a rich array of alternatives, the otherwise strict regulation for the production of Capalbio D.O.C. wines has encouraged the winemakers to constantly strive to improve their wines.
